温馨提示×

深度学习

pytorch多线程如何优化性能

小樊
81
2024-12-25 21:29:28

PyTorch是一个基于Python的科学计算库,主要用于深度学习研究。在PyTorch中,多线程可以通过以下方式优化性能: 1. **数据加载和预处理**: - 使用`torch.utils...

0

pytorch多线程资源竞争咋办

小樊
81
2024-12-25 21:28:28

在PyTorch中,多线程可能会导致资源竞争问题,特别是在使用`DataLoader`进行数据加载时。以下是一些建议来解决这些问题: 1. 使用`num_workers`参数:在创建`DataLoa...

0

pytorch多线程与单线程对比

小樊
81
2024-12-25 21:27:43

PyTorch是一个广泛应用于深度学习的开源库,它支持多线程和单线程运行,各自适用于不同的场景。以下是对PyTorch中多线程与单线程的对比: ### PyTorch中的多线程与单线程 - **单...

0

pytorch多线程如何调试

小樊
84
2024-12-25 21:26:33

在PyTorch中进行多线程调试时,开发者可以采用多种策略和工具来定位和解决问题。以下是一些关键的调试技巧和工具,以及多线程在PyTorch中的应用场景。 ### PyTorch多线程调试技巧 -...

0

pytorch多线程并发数咋定

小樊
82
2024-12-25 21:25:26

PyTorch的多线程并发数通常取决于您的硬件资源和任务类型。一般来说,您可以考虑以下几点来确定合适的并发数: 1. CPU核心数:您需要了解您的计算机有多少个CPU核心。这可以通过在Python中...

0

pytorch多线程如何管理

小樊
84
2024-12-25 21:24:28

PyTorch是一个基于Python的科学计算库,主要用于深度学习研究。在PyTorch中,多线程可以通过`torch.utils.data.DataLoader`和`torch.nn.DataPar...

0

pytorch多线程内存占用多少

小樊
82
2024-12-25 21:23:25

PyTorch的多线程内存占用取决于多个因素,包括模型的复杂性、输入数据的大小、线程的数量以及PyTorch的版本等。因此,很难给出一个具体的数字来回答“PyTorch多线程内存占用多少”这个问题。 ...

0

pytorch多线程适用哪些场景

小樊
81
2024-12-25 21:22:33

PyTorch中多线程主要适用于I/O密集型任务,如数据加载和预处理等,可以提高程序的执行效率。然而,在考虑使用多线程时,也需要注意其局限性。 ### PyTorch多线程适用场景 - **数据加...

0

pytorch多线程如何同步

小樊
84
2024-12-25 21:21:28

在PyTorch中,多线程可以通过使用`torch.utils.data.DataLoader`来实现数据加载的并行化。为了确保多线程之间的同步,可以使用以下方法: 1. 使用`torch.util...

0

pytorch多线程数据共享吗

小樊
84
2024-12-25 21:20:25

在PyTorch中,多线程数据共享通常是通过数据加载器(DataLoader)来实现的。数据加载器可以自动处理数据的并行加载和共享,从而提高训练速度。在多线程环境下,数据加载器会将数据分成多个部分,每...

0